Pareto optimality: an allocation of resources in which no one can be made better off without making at least one other person worse off.
Pareto improvement: a reallocation that makes at least one person better off and no one worse off.
- Pareto optimality is the economist's benchmark for an efficient allocation of resources.
- At that point all gains from reallocating resources are exhausted.
- It is used to judge whether a market has allocated resources efficiently.
- While any Pareto improvement remains, resources are still being wasted.
- Pareto optimality judges efficiency only, never fairness.
Testing an Allocation
- Start from any allocation and look for a change that helps someone at no one's expense.
- If such a change exists, the allocation is not yet Pareto optimal.
- Keep making these changes until none is left, and the final point is Pareto optimal.
- On eBay a buyer pays £30 for a used phone they value at £45, while the seller valued it at only £20.
- The buyer gains £15 of surplus and the seller £10, and no third party loses, so the original 'no-trade' position was not Pareto optimal → the trade is a Pareto improvement.
- Once every mutually beneficial trade has happened and no further swap helps anyone without harming another, the allocation is Pareto optimal.
Link to Markets
- A perfectly competitive market such as foreign exchange reaches a Pareto-optimal allocation, where price = marginal cost.
- Market failure moves the economy away from Pareto optimality, leaving further gains from trade unrealised.
- So Pareto optimality links efficiency to the wider study of market failure and intervention.
Efficiency, Not Fairness
- Pareto optimality tells us only whether the gains from reallocation are exhausted.
- It says nothing about whether the distribution of resources is fair or equitable.
- An allocation where one person owns almost everything can still be Pareto optimal, because taking from them to help others makes them worse off.
- Suppose one household holds £100 of a fixed pot and another holds £0; any transfer to the second reduces the first's share, so the extreme split is already Pareto optimal.
- Most people would call that outcome efficient but not equitable, which is why governments pursue equity goals even in an efficient market.
